.container.svelte-1x05zx6{min-height:100vh;max-width:400px;margin:0 auto;padding:40px 20px;background:var(--bg-primary);color:var(--text-body)}.back.svelte-1x05zx6{display:inline-block;color:var(--text-muted);text-decoration:none;margin-bottom:20px}.back.svelte-1x05zx6:hover{color:var(--text-body)}.card.svelte-1x05zx6{background:var(--bg-card);border:1px solid var(--border);padding:32px;border-radius:12px}h1.svelte-1x05zx6{margin:0 0 24px;font-size:1.5rem;text-align:center;color:var(--text-primary)}.field.svelte-1x05zx6{margin-bottom:16px}label.svelte-1x05zx6{display:block;margin-bottom:6px;font-size:14px;color:var(--text-body)}input.svelte-1x05zx6{width:100%;padding:12px;font-size:16px;background:var(--bg-card);border:1.5px solid var(--border);border-radius:8px;outline:none;box-sizing:border-box;color:var(--text-body)}input.svelte-1x05zx6::placeholder{color:var(--text-dim)}input.svelte-1x05zx6:focus{border-color:var(--accent)}button[type=submit].svelte-1x05zx6{width:100%;padding:14px;font-size:16px;background:var(--accent-gradient);color:#fff;border:none;border-radius:8px;cursor:pointer;margin-top:8px}button[type=submit].svelte-1x05zx6:hover:not(:disabled){background:var(--accent-gradient-hover)}button.svelte-1x05zx6:disabled{opacity:.6;cursor:not-allowed}.error.svelte-1x05zx6{background:var(--bg-card);border:1px solid var(--error-border);color:var(--error-text);padding:12px;border-radius:8px;margin-bottom:16px;font-size:14px}.success.svelte-1x05zx6{background:var(--bg-card);border:1px solid var(--success-text);color:var(--success-text);padding:12px;border-radius:8px;margin-bottom:16px;font-size:14px}.register-link.svelte-1x05zx6{text-align:center;margin-top:20px;font-size:14px;color:var(--text-muted)}.register-link.svelte-1x05zx6 a:where(.svelte-1x05zx6){color:var(--accent)}.register-link.svelte-1x05zx6 a:where(.svelte-1x05zx6):hover{color:var(--accent-hover)}
